How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Montlake?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Montlake Studio Apartments | $1,667 | $795 | $7,107 |
Montlake 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,896 | $720 | $10,000+ |
Montlake 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,947 | $919 | $10,000+ |
Montlake 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,415 | $1,099 | $10,000+ |
Montlake 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,862 | $875 | $8,760 |
Montlake 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,643 | $1,270 | $4,975 |
Montlake 6 Bedroom Apartments | $1,468 | $858 | $5,148 |

Getting Around the Montlake Neighborhood in Seattle, WA
Walk Score®
70 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
81 / 100
Very Bikeable
Biking is convenient for most trips
Transit Score®
54 / 100
Good Transit
Many nearby public transportation options
